Riverdale Pays Beautiful Homage to Luke Perry in Hedwig Musical Episode
popsugar Brea Cubit
2020-04-16 17:34:02

Image Source: The CWBack home, Archie practices his guitar until a string breaks. He goes into the garage and finds Fred's old guitar used in his former band, The Fred Heads. It's a touching moment, but Riverdale gives us another tear-jerker later in the episode when Archie and Betty comfort each other after they get into arguments with Veronica and Jughead. Archie reveals that participating in ...

Read More